I am installing drivers going through HP Easy Start. I am at the part where it asks for use which I select In the home for personal use. A box is below that requires numbers? What numbers do I enter here. It doesn't let me leave blank and doesn't say what to enter.

I understand you're at a step in HP Easy Start that is asking for numbers, but it's unclear what type of numbers are required. Typically, HP Easy Start should not ask for numbers unless it's related to something like:
- Serial Number: This can be found on your printer, usually on a label at the back or bottom of the printer.
- Product Number: Similar to the serial number, but specific to your printer model.
- ZIP Code: Some setups ask for your location details, like ZIP code for localized services.
- WPS PIN: If you're setting up the printer via Wi-Fi, it might request a WPS PIN, which can be found on your router.
